Hello, I noticed that when I send an email from my phone, and I click my name in the received email to see my address, this address pops up:

imceaex-_o=first+20organization_ou=exchange+20administrative+20group+28fydibohf23spdlt+29_cn=recipients_cn=00037ffe9f0dd45e@sct-15-20-4755-11-msonline-outlook-50200.templatetenant

I just thought this looked strange and was wondering if it's normal.

    Is your account a business account using an on-prem Exchange service or an Exchange service that was migrated to Microsoft 365 for business? The address is an X.500 address and may indicate that your proxy address isn't properly configured. This is something the Exchange or M365 tenant administrator will need to address.
